随着网络游戏的普及,游戏服务器已成为网络游戏中不可或缺的一部分。游戏服务器作为承载大量玩家同时在线、处理游戏内逻辑运算、数据存储等任务的关键组件,其性能直接决定了游戏体验的好坏。与传统的企业级应用服务器或Web服务器相比,游戏服务器有着更为特殊的要求。
高性能计算能力
由于游戏中的物理碰撞检测、角色属性变化、技能释放等操作都需要实时计算,这就要求服务器具备强大的CPU和GPU处理能力。对于一些大型MMORPG(大型多人在线角色扮演游戏),还需要支持复杂的AI算法和大规模并行计算。如果服务器无法满足这些需求,则可能会导致游戏卡顿、延迟等问题,影响玩家的游戏体验。
高带宽和低延迟网络连接
为了保证游戏画面流畅传输以及指令快速响应,游戏服务器必须拥有足够的带宽来支持众多客户端的同时连接,并且要尽可能地降低网络延迟。这通常意味着需要采用更高级别的硬件设施和优化后的网络架构,如使用光纤通信技术、部署CDN节点等措施来提高传输速度。
大容量存储空间
除了运行时所需的内存资源外,游戏服务器还需要保存大量的用户信息、道具装备数据等内容。特别是对于那些包含丰富剧情元素或者允许玩家自定义内容的作品而言,所需占用的磁盘空间会更加庞大。在选择服务器时也要充分考虑其硬盘容量是否足够。
稳定性和安全性保障
游戏服务器往往承载着数以万计甚至更多的活跃用户,任何一次意外宕机都可能导致严重的经济损失。所以它们需要具备更高的可靠性和容错性,例如通过集群部署实现负载均衡和故障转移。为了防止黑客攻击、作弊行为等破坏正常秩序的情况发生,安全防护机制也是必不可少的一环。
游戏服务器之所以需要特殊配置,主要是因为它们面临着比其他类型服务器更为复杂多变的工作环境。只有当所有硬件参数达到最优状态并且软件层面也进行了针对性调整后,才能确保为玩家们提供一个稳定、高效且公平的竞争平台。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/150744.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。